Finding the Best Spot for Your Dumpster

Choosing a proper location ensures safety and efficiency during delivery. The location should be flat, stable, and accessible for the delivery truck. Do not place dumpsters on unstable or sloped surfaces, or in areas blocked by obstacles. Correct placement safeguards your property and simplifies loading, reducing risk of damage.

Consider additional factors such as traffic patterns, driveway width, and clearance from overhead obstacles like tree branches or wires. For projects with multiple pickups, positioning dumpsters carefully avoids congestion and keeps work efficient. If placing a dumpster on public property or near the street, make sure you have any required permits. These steps help prevent disruptions and maintain an efficient work site.

How to Load Your Dumpster Correctly

Efficient loading of your dumpster helps optimize space and prevent accidents. Distribute heavy materials evenly at the bottom and lighter items on top. Avoid piling materials above the rim of the container, as this can create hazards during transport. Maintaining an organized load prevents hazards and makes the dumpster easier and safer to transport.

Separating different materials like construction debris, yard waste, and household items helps organize your load. Proper segregation speeds up disposal and maximizes space utilization. Keep flammable or toxic materials out of the dumpster unless approved. Adhering to safe loading practices keeps your team protected and ensures compliance.
